We will be working on a patch of scrub near the NW corner of the reserve , see the aerial photo on left.
The orange line will be a dead hedge location, using the existing trees (on the same side as the scrub block) to make some of the posts.
The main idea is to open out a triangle at the junction, but then extending west and south from there. West as far as a ride that has now been overgrown and blocked, and south as far as we get.It will take more than one day!
We plan to experiment with leaving a few more standing trees than before and create more of a mosaic rather than a cleared block.
The overall aim of choosing this bit is to create another opening with light from the south, and where there is already bramble and Dog Rose on the north, as a clearing that may attract the Silver Washed Fritillaries.
